Поделиться через


Функция DisableThreadProfiling (winbase.h)

Отключает профилирование потоков.

Синтаксис

DWORD DisableThreadProfiling(
  [in] HANDLE PerformanceDataHandle
);

Параметры

[in] PerformanceDataHandle

Дескриптор, возвращенный функцией EnableThreadProfiling .

Возвращаемое значение

Возвращает ERROR_SUCCESS, если вызов выполнен успешно; в противном случае — системный код ошибки (см. Winerror.h).

Комментарии

Эту функцию необходимо вызвать из того же потока, который включил профилирование для указанного дескриптора. Эту функцию необходимо вызвать перед выходом из потока; в противном случае произойдет утечка ресурсов (ресурсы не освобождаются до завершения процесса).

Требования

Требование Значение
Минимальная версия клиента Windows 7 [только классические приложения]
Минимальная версия сервера Windows Server 2008 R2 [только классические приложения]
Целевая платформа Windows
Header winbase.h (включая Windows.h)
Библиотека Kernel32.lib
DLL Kernel32.dll

См. также

EnableThreadProfiling

QueryThreadProfiling